Dog trapped in river for days – then men free it in emotional rescue

When a dog got herself stuck in a muddy river bank in Ulysses, Kentucky, it was only a matter of time before the situation became dire.

13-year-old Ginger, a golden retriever, had been missing from her home for five-days, and her family was desperate to find her. Fortunately for them, the brother of the dog’s owner found Ginger stuck in serious trouble, and, along with a group of others, jumped into a rescue effort to save her life.

Darrell Perkins heard his sister’s dog howling down by the river, and so immediately called dog warden Johnny Rickman.

Rickman soon arrived on scene with his trusty harness; a piece of equipment that would be crucial in freeing Ginger from the river bank.

Ginger couldn’t walk up the hill, and it was clear that she could easily have drowned.

But, thanks to the incredible efforts of the humans who found her, she’s now recovering at a local animal hospital and is expected to make a full recovery.
